i think a few lads on here have got it upto around the 240 mark with a bit of flowing and polishing here and there  :y

a point too remember though, a omega with plenty of fuel and a couple of people on board weighs close to 2 ton so its never gonna complete with the fastest hot hatches away from the lights  :(
but once you get upto 60 ish, its gonna fly  :y

opinion is divided on chips
stick with the air box and a good quality air filter to fit in it  :y
if you remove the airbox, you get more noise but less power  >:(    too much warm air in that corner 

the 2.6 / 3.2 manifold is abit better designed and i believe gives a bit more scope for tunning  :y
